Dec 9, 2025 • 5min
Optimize Your Sleep
Cognitive neuroscientist Lucas Miller shares impactful strategies to improve sleep and daytime energy. He emphasizes the importance of quality sleep for optimal performance and discusses the cognitive and health risks associated with insufficient rest. Lucas recommends avoiding caffeine eight hours before bed and explains how aligning alarm clocks with your sleep cycle can lead to refreshed mornings. He also introduces the innovative 'nappuccino' method—combining a short nap with caffeine for a revitalizing boost!
